ST. PETERSBURG, Fla. – The Saint Leo baseball team opened its series at Eckerd with a dominate 10-4 victory on Friday night in Sunshine State Conference (SSC) action.
Junior
Ryan Crivello drove in a pair of runs with a single down the left field line before the Tritons answered with a two-run homer in the second. Junior
Thomas DeBrower stole home to give the Lions a 3-2 edge. The Green and Gold offense scored seven consecutive runs to lead by a 10-2 margin. Eckerd tallied a pair of runs in the seventh before being shut down for the remainder of the game.
On the bump, junior
Tyler Mecchella started and pitched 6.1 innings with three strikeouts while allowing four runs on six hits as he was tabbed with the win.
The Lions return to action on Saturday, May 3 as it concludes its series at Eckerd with a doubleheader starting at 1 p.m.
